Здравствуйте.
Столкнулся с такой проблемой: не работает mod_rewrite, выдает ошибку 404.
Т.е. на запрос
http://192.168.1.xx/temp/test.html вылазит 404 ошибка.
Хотя по запросу:
http://192.168.1.xx/temp/index.php?p=test все работает.
Вот часть текста с /etc/apache2/sites-enabled/000-default
<VirtualHost *:80>
ServerAdmin webmaster@localhost
DocumentRoot /var/www/
<Directory />
Options FollowSymLinks
AllowOverride None
</Directory>
<Directory /var/www/>
Options Indexes FollowSymLinks MultiViews
AllowOverride All
Order allow,deny
allow from all
</Directory>
# в этой директории лежит сайт
<Directory /var/www/temp/>
Options Indexes FollowSymLinks MultiViews Includes
AllowOverride All
Order allow,deny
allow from all
</Directory>
..........
Полный текст тут:
http://slil.ru/29554002
Файл .htaccess в папке /var/www/temp/ :
RewriteEngine on
RewriteRule ^.htaccess$ -[F]
RewriteRule ^([^/]*)\.html$ /index.php?p=$1 [L]
-----------------------------------
Выражения в rewrite правильное (работает в windows denwer и на стороннем хостинге)
rewrite подключен через #a2enmod rewrite
Пробовал прописывать выражение в сам 000-default - так же безрезультатно.
Заранее спасибо.
Примечание:
В логах /var/log/apache2/error.log фигурирует в основном такая запись:
[Thu Aug 23 13:53][error] [client 192.168.1.1] script '/var/www/index.php' not found or unable to stat, referer: http: //192.168.1.210/temp
RPI.su - самая большая русскоязычная база вопросов и ответов. Наш проект был реализован как продолжение популярного сервиса otvety.google.ru, который был закрыт и удален 30 апреля 2015 года. Мы решили воскресить полезный сервис Ответы Гугл, чтобы любой человек смог публично узнать ответ на свой вопрос у интернет сообщества.
Все вопросы, добавленные на сайт ответов Google, мы скопировали и сохранили здесь. Имена старых пользователей также отображены в том виде, в котором они существовали ранее. Только нужно заново пройти регистрацию, чтобы иметь возможность задавать вопросы, или отвечать другим.
Чтобы связаться с нами по любому вопросу О САЙТЕ (реклама, сотрудничество, отзыв о сервисе), пишите на почту [email protected]. Только все общие вопросы размещайте на сайте, на них ответ по почте не предоставляется.